Book excerpt: 'A gripping political thriller, a masterpiece of investigative journalism' Peter Manseau, author of Rag and Bone The secretive Christian fundamentalist group known as 'The Family' is leading a new crusade for 'God-led government'.Jeff Sharlet, authorThe Family (more than 100,000 copies sold worldwide), is the only journalist to have reported from insidethe organisation. The Family garnered intense media coverage in 2009 when theirtownhouse on Washington's C Street was central to three Republican sex scandals. Now Sharlet uncovers the convert efforts of C Street to transform the very fabric of Western democracy, with the Family, steeped in the influence and corruption usually associated with the notorious lobbing industry, fueling political fundamentalism from within government. When Barack Obama took office, headlines declared the age of culture wars over. In C Street, Sharlet show why these conflicts endure and why they matter now-from Uganda, where culture warriors are determined to eradicate homosexuality, to the battle for the soul of America's armed forces. Reporting with exclusive sources and explosives documents, Sharlet reveals the terrifying new front-lines of fundamentalism. Book excerpt: The financial crisis that began in 2008 has made Americans keenly aware of the enormous impact Wall Street has on the economic well-being of the nation and its citizenry. How did financial markets and institutions-commonly perceived as marginal and elitist at the beginning of the twentieth century-come to be seen as the bedrock of American capitalism? How did stock investment-once considered disreputable and dangerous-first become a mass practice? Julia Ott tells the story of how, between the rise of giant industrial corporations and the Crash of 1929, the federal government, corporations, and financial institutions campaigned to universalize investment, with the goal of providing individual investors with a stake in the economy and the nation. As these distributors of stocks and bonds established a broad, national market for financial securities, they debated the distribution of economic power, the proper role of government, and the meaning of citizenship under modern capitalism. By 1929, the incidence of stock ownership had risen to engulf one quarter of American households in the looming financial disaster. Accordingly, the federal government assumed responsibility for protecting citizen-investors by regulating the financial securities markets. By recovering the forgotten history of this initial phase of mass investment and the issues surrounding it, Ott enriches and enlightens contemporary debates over economic reform.

Book excerpt: How World War II changed New Castle, Indiana. “This is a unique look at the war, far from the front lines, but equally impacting life on the home front.” —Bookviews.com The War Comes to Plum Street brings to life the Second World War through the eyes of a small group of neighbors from a Midwestern town. Bruce C. Smith presents their stories just as they happened, without explanation or interpretation. To experience the war as they did, insofar as it is possible, we must understand how they perceived everyday events and recognize the incompleteness of their knowledge of what was taking place in Europe and the Pacific. The inhabitants of Plum Street in New Castle, Indiana, resemble many other average Americans of their day.
